Boeing 3D-Printed Solar Array Substrates

Solar array substrates for spacecraft

Aerospace85% confidence
AEROSPACE · PART PHOTO
Challenge

Solar array substrates for satellites are complex, require precise flatness and low mass, and are traditionally slow and expensive to produce.

Solution

Boeing uses 3D printing to create solar array substrates, cutting production time in half compared to conventional fabrication methods.
